第三阶段词汇表(分课型按课文排列) 听说词汇 1. self-conscious (a.):nervous or embarrassed about your appearance or what other people think of you不自然的;忸怩的 2. introverted (a.): examining own sensory and perceptual experiences; introspective内向的,含蓄的,闭关自守的 3. belonging (n.):happiness felt in a secure relationship归属感 4. startled (a.):excited by sudden surprise or alarm and making a quick involuntary movement震惊的 5. confused (a.):being unable to think with clarity or act with understanding and intelligence困惑的 6. disoriented (a.):having lost your bearings; confused as to time or place or personal identity不知所措的 7. myth (n.):a traditional story about heroes or supernatural beings, often attempting to explain the origins of natural phenomena or aspects of human behavior神话 8. critical (a.):inclined to judge severely and find fault爱挑剔的 9. startled (a.):alarmed, frightened, or surprised震惊的 10. conscious (a.) :subjectively known or felt有意识的 11. wardrobe (n.):a tall cabinet, closet, or small room built to hold clothes; the clothes a person owns衣橱 12. chatter (vi.):to talk rapidly, incessantly, and on trivial subjects喋喋不休; 唠叨 13. inwardness (n.):preoccupation with one’s own thoughts or feelings内在性质;本质 14. incredible (a.):impossible or very difficult to believe难以置信的 15. nigger (n.):used as a disparaging term for a black person黑人(此称呼被看作是对黑人的极大侮辱) 16. freeze(v.):to become unable to act or react, as from fear惊呆 17. defend (v.):to make or keep safe from danger, attack, or harm保卫,防守 18. insult (vt.):to make an offensive action or remark侮辱, 冒犯 19. racist (n.):a person who discriminates or has prejudice against people of other races种族歧视者 20. timid (a.): showing fear and lack of confidence羞怯的;胆怯的;缺乏勇气的 21. scary (a.): so scary as to cause chills and shudders使人惊恐的;吓人的;可怕的 22. casino (n.):a public building for gambling and entertainment赌场;娱乐场 23. felony (n.): a serious crime (such as murder or arson) 律重罪 24. fraudulent (a.): intended to deceive欺骗的, 欺诈的, 不诚实的25. beyond my reach: unable to
